The main reason I dislike aeon so much is particularly because capcom has this strange thing that they do where they don't really show us how in love they are, they TELL us. If your characters were genuinely as in love and enthralled with each other as you say they are, we wouldn't need every character they interact with to TELL us they're in love.
i.e: "sounds like you know her well" from RE4R, "you have feelings for her dont you?" from RE6, "I can't believe i actually miss her" from RE2R, etc
You do not need to constantly vocalize how in love they are if they're truly in love and the games do it so much that it becomes repetitive. Someone's always asking Leon about Ada and TELLING him his feelings for her instead of us being shown that hes longing for and pining for her.
And this doesnt work specifically because of Leon's dry, cynical attitude toward Ada even in the original games. Their chemistry doesn't actually start working (in a sense) until RE6 but in 6 its basically forced down the players' throats.
Not to mention (especially in the 4 remake) Ada has a very odd boredness around Leon that people claim she uses as a way to hide her feelings for him. But I bring you this as a counter: her attitude toward Luis in the Separate Ways DLC.
Ada shows more genuine joy and emotion around Luis than she does toward Leon (even in the other games (maybe beside 6)). At one point she even giggles and smiles at him (which she has NEVER done to Leon):
She is constantly angry and exasperated with Luis the same way she is with Leon but the difference is that it doesn't feel as mocking toward Luis as it does Leon. She softens a lot easier around Luis even in their very limited screen time and interactions.
She has only ever ALLOWED Luis to touch her. With Leon, SHE is the one dictating the interaction and how its going to work. With Luis, she is less harsh about it and actually allows him to support her and help her in a way Leon has not.

She is very adamant about keeping Leon very far at arm's length and that COULD be because she has repressed feelings for him but it NEVER comes off that way. She is much more vibrant and emotional around Luis which we NEVER get to see around Leon. She's somewhat flirty and joking around Leon but not in the same way she is with Luis.
Aeon (imo) feels forced. Like capcom is TELLING us "hey, theyre meant for each other" when its not VISIBLE and not FELT like Leon/Ada's interactions are with other characters. Leon has more chemistry with Chris in Vendetta ALONE than he has with Ada. They feel meant for other characters but theyre being forced together in a way that feels clunky and badly written.
Capcom CANNOT just allow Ada to be a character without attaching her to Leon. Leon has his own arcs and development but she feels (ESPECIALLY IN THE OLD GAMES) like an accessory to him in the way her story and arc almost always completely revolve around him.
The Separate Ways DLC was changed SO much and it seems like they were trying to remedy it but even STILL she was constantly being stuck back to Leon and unallowed to have her own growth. She is the same old Ada because she can't become a different Ada if she's still attached to Leon's hip in the way capcom DESPERATELY needs her to be. Their relationship feels very surface level and forced. My biggest example of this is the kiss in RE2R. I've always had a problem with this scene particularly because aeon crusaders use it as a "GOTCHA!" moment to prove that theyre in love.
Ada seems disingenuous and Leon doesnt look overcome with love. Ada does this--not as impulse--but as a calculated move to catch Leon off guard and manipulate him into doing what she NEEDS him to do. It is her act of duty because she is immobile, injured, and a liability. She needs to act fast. So she does.
Leon does not react with wonder. He reacts with confusion. He does not look in love. He moves on from it very quickly. He appears to be questioning her and himself immediately after it is over. He does not react.
That is abject confusion.
I cannot say the same for the og re2 cause the graphics are pixels and the VA work is so bad that its hard to tell any emotion from it. But I can say in confidence that the kiss scene here does not seem to represent love at first sight.

What particularly drives me crazy is that Aeon is in retrospect a very toxic ship that doesnt work between either of them. Ada treats Leon like a constant: "i dont have to work on this because he'll always be here waiting for me." And Leon always comes out of the otherside of their interactions worse off than he entered (think about the transition in his appearance and mental state from RE6 to Vendetta: the loss of weight, sarcastically dark hair, HEAVY alcohol use, increased suicidality) and of course this is affected by outside trauma as well, but it also has to do with Ada and her lingering influence on him that capcom must have in every game she appears in. It drags him down, makes him worse, and he never gets closure.
Ada also never gets closure because she pulls away before she can to avoid it for as long as possible. Which then just boils their dynamic down to "this is mysterious because we never communicate or accept each other into our lives" which in addition to the awful emotional layout capcom has done, just makes the ship extremely frustrating.
